Output 35aa32ac829d1752ccf5c7b9f662437994ebf0618283438157c86728ae0af9ab:1

value
67347262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de2cd623689f84857c53bacd32b80f88037514df OP_EQUAL
address
3MwmeRVtpvtNxfL86STYXgpkNXSyPjRaUT
transaction
35aa32ac829d1752ccf5c7b9f662437994ebf0618283438157c86728ae0af9ab
spent
true